An adverse event (AE) is defined as any untoward medical occurrence in a participant administered study drug, which does not necessarily have to have a causal relationship with the study drug. A TEAE is an adverse event that occurs on or after the first dose of study treatment. The number of participants with TEAEs graded according to National Cancer Institute (NCI) Common Terminology Criteria for Adverse Events (CTCAE) version 5.0 (American Society for Transplant and Cellular Therapy \[ASTCT\] grading criteria for cytokine release syndrome \[CRS\] and immune effector cell-associated neurotoxicity syndrome \[ICANS\]) will be reported.
An AE is defined as any untoward medical occurrence in a participant administered study drug, which does not necessarily have to have a causal relationship with the study drug. The number of participants who discontinue study treatment due to an AE will be reported.
A DLT is defined as an event with toxicity including the type, severity, time of onset, time of resolution, and the probable association with study treatment that are not due to pre-existing conditions as defined by the CTCAE 5.0 version for all AEs except CRS and ICANS, which will be graded according to ASTCT. The number of participants who experience a DLT will be reported.

| Arm | Type | Description |
|---|---|---|
| MK-4002 monotherapy dose escalation | EXPERIMENTAL | MK-4002 is intravenously (IV) administered once weekly in escalating doses. |
| MK-4002 dose escalation with extended dosing intervals | EXPERIMENTAL | MK-4002 is IV administered once every 2 weeks. |
